Is 258 752 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 258 752 is about 508.677.

Thus, the square root of 258 752 is not an integer, and therefore 258 752 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 258 752?

The square of a number (here 258 752) is the result of the product of this number (258 752) by itself (i.e., 258 752 × 258 752); the square of 258 752 is sometimes called "raising 258 752 to the power 2", or "258 752 squared".

The square of 258 752 is 66 952 597 504 because 258 752 × 258 752 = 258 7522 = 66 952 597 504.

As a consequence, 258 752 is the square root of 66 952 597 504.
